The first top quality RCT (Chu et al., 2004) randomized individuals to obtain an aquatic lower extremity program or a land-based upper extremity coaching program. Self-selected gait pace (m/sec) was measured over an 8-meter strolling test at post-treatment (8 weeks). A significant between-group difference was discovered, in favour of aquatic therapy vs. upper extremity coaching. The fourth prime quality RCT (Saleh, Rehab & Aly, 2019) randomized members to obtain aquatic motor twin task training or land-based motor twin task coaching. Dynamic stability was measured utilizing the Biodex Stability System (Overall Stability Index, Anteroposterior Stability Index, Mediolateral Stability Index) at post-treatment (6 weeks).

The time period ‘neuromuscular training’ is commonly reported within the literature todescribe subcomponents of steadiness, proprioception, agility and plyometric training. Nevertheless,since every sort of training (except visualisation) entails nerve and muscle action, wechose to use the term ‘motor control’ to higher distinguish fromstrength/resistance training. Strength and motor control coaching must be mixed in therehabilitation protocol and one can not replace the opposite. Core stability workout routines might enhance functional outcomes and subjectiveknee function and can be utilized as an addition to the rehabilitation protocol.
